JOB PURPOSE
An exciting opportunity to join the Company team. In the role you will be partnering with the Bond Street store team to ensure VM strategy and standards are correctly implemented in the most productive way possible.
RESPONSIBILITIES
• To Implement Corporate Visual Merchandising policies and standards throughout the Bond Street store and windows.
• To partner with the Bond Street store team to maximise sales opportunities whilst maintaining the corporate standards and brand image.
• To partner and cooperate with Corporate VM as required on windows and in store VM.
• To assist the VM senior in the coordination and implementation of store changes to accommodate events and marketing activity.
• Regular reporting to the regent st senior VM to update them of the status, strengths and weakness of their areas of responsibility.
• To be responsible for merchandise used by the display team and to ensure this is accounted for and cared for properly
• To assist the senior VM to organize and conduct in-store training sessions on visual merchandising guidelines and visual merchandising standards to store staff each season. To train the in store VM specialist for the store, ensuring that they are motivated and full aware of corporate guidelines and strategy.
• To demonstrate awareness of current advertising and marketing campaigns, new product launches and promotions.
